🦧 Today is International Orangutan Day—a reminder that these gentle forest dwellers are critically endangered.

Did you know Orangutans share 97% of our DNA? Yet in just the past 60 years, their populations have dropped by more than half—driven by deforestation, habitat loss, and the illegal wildlife trade.

💔 Without action, Orangutans could disappear from the wild within our lifetime.

Will we be the generation that let Tigers go extinct? 🐅💔

Three of Asia’s majestic Tigers—Sumatran, Malayan, and South China—are now Critically Endangered.
The South China Tiger may already be gone from the wild.

What’s driving them to the edge?
🚨 Poaching for body parts
🪵 Habitat destroyed by palm oil and logging
🏘️ Rising human-wildlife conflict

🐻 Did you know Moon Bears make nests in trees?

It’s true! These clever climbers sometimes build “day beds” high in the branches, using leaves and sticks to rest, cool off, and escape ground predators — a rare behavior among Bears! 🌿🛌

Why do they do this? Just like us, they enjoy a cool breeze and a little peace and quiet now and then. 💚

🐆 Meet Rani—an Indian Leopard (Panthera pardus fusca) now living in peace at our partner RESQ Charitable Trust's sanctuary.

Indian Leopards are incredibly adaptable—but habitat loss, human-wildlife conflict, and poaching are pushing them to the brink.

Rani, estimated to be 16 years old, was rescued after years in captivity. Despite old injuries and chronic health issues, she remains alert, gentle, and deeply bonded to her companion, John.

Thanks to the compassionate care of RESQ Charitable Trust, Rani is thriving—on her own terms.

Covered in armor, but defenseless against us. Pangolins are gentle, nocturnal creatures—and the most trafficked mammals on Earth. 💔

Hunted for their scales and driven from their habitats, all eight species are now at risk of extinction.

A powerful new documentary from Netflix , Pangolin: Kulu’s Journey, sheds light on the harsh reality of the illegal wildlife trade—and the quiet, determined efforts to save these remarkable animals.
